Primark unveils brand new summer range that’s ‘ideal for brunch or picnic dates’ in pastel colours & prices start at £6

FASHION giant Primark has unveiled its chic new summer range, complete with waistcoat sets, Peter Pan collar blouses and floral co-ords.
The high street store has upped its fashion game in recent months, including celebrity partnerships and producing bang-on-trend pieces at affordable prices.
Now, as we approach warmer weather, designers at the retailer have unveiled their latest creations - perfect for hot days in the UK and holiday wear alike.
Primark has even jumped on the butter yellow trend, which fashionistas have declared as the colour of the summer.
There’s the £20 Strapless Buttoned Vest, which comes with matching shorts or trousers, also priced at £20 a pop.
“Butter yellow is a soft, creamy shade of yellow that looks just like butter,” Primark bosses said.
“A pastel between pale yellow and beige, it hits the right balance between quiet luxury and dopamine dressing.
“This easy-to-wear shade pairs well with neutrals like ivory, tan and black - a versatile go-to for everyday looks.
“For wedding guests and spring special events, there’s no better way to turn heads than in butter yellow.
“Dressed up or down, the blazer takes your dressy-casual look next level.”
Primark has also introduced a black floral pattern, which comes on a £22 Floral V-Neck Midi Dress, as well as a short and shirt co-ord for £20.
“The all-over yellow flower print gives it a lovely, summery feel,” bosses said.
“Perfect for picnics, parties or just looking effortlessly gorgeous with minimal effort.”
Among the blouse offerings is a new £16 Scallop Collar Blouse which comes in three prints, including a blue, yellow and white striped design.
A blurb reads: “Say hello to your new favourite: the Scallop Collar Blouse.
“This long-sleeved top features a statement scallop-edged collar for a sweet detail.
“Perfect for dressing up or down, this blouse is a versatile addition to your collection.”
There's also tees for £8, linen shorts for £12 and sandals for as cheap as £6.
